In an initiative, citizens or non-government groups gather petition signatures for a proposed new law to be placed on the ballot. The citizens vote on the initiative, and if it passes, it becomes a law even without the legislature or the governor voting on it.

A referendum is a citizen action to repeal a law passed by the legislature.

Not all states allow initiative and referendum. California, for example, does.
